    • Responsibilities and Duties

    • Create and implement treatment plans, complete necessary documentation within a week of service, participate in supervision and consultation as needed, creatively meet individual needs within your own spin, style, and modality
    • Full-time clinicians are expected to conduct 25 hours of client contact per week (individual, group, couple, or family) - we help you find and schedule your clients!
    • Coordinate services as needed with other internal and external providers
    • Attend and participate in all staff meetings and trainings
    • Participate in outreach efforts as needed
    • Identify innovative ways to fill need gaps and best serve our community
    • Collaborate with leadership to meet company and individual goals
    • Required Qualifications :

    • Completed Master's degree in a license-eligible field (Social Work, Counseling, Marriage & Family Therapy, Etc.)
    • Registered (or eligible to) with DORA as a fully licensed clinician (LPC, LMFT, LCSW)
    • Experience with completing clinical documentation
    • Effective written and verbal communication skills
    • Experience and willingness to work collaboratively and creatively to meet necessary deadlines
    • Comfort and familiarity working with clients with a diverse range of concerns
    • Proficient in the use of typical office technology (computers, e-mail, etc.) and Electronic Health Record systems (Valant experience a plus!)
    • Ability to pass a background check in a way that tells us you're able to provide safe care
    • Comfort with the natural ambiguity and excitement of a new clinic branch
